Concerns over draft proposals relating to posted workers
Chief policy director Katja Hall sets out the CBI's main concerns with draft single market proposals
Chief policy director Katja Hall has contacted senior figures in the European Commission, in order to set out the CBI’s main concerns with draft single market proposals aimed at clarifying the right to collective action and ensuring better enforcement of the posted workers directive.
In particular, the move to introduce a novel system of joint and several liability as an enforcement mechanism within the posted workers directive will layer significant costs on firms that look to contract across borders. The CBI hopes that the Commission will listen to the manifold concerns of British and European industry before the final proposals are adopted.
